Ticket: Config drift on Larkmoor partner SFTP drop

Nightly audit flagged drift between the Larkmoor SFTP ingest nodes. Node two is rejecting partner uploads; node one accepts them. Someone hand-edited node two last week and it was never reconciled. Do not restart either node until files clear the queue. For reference, the expected baseline configuration is as follows.

config for kafof-bawef:
holath:
  log_level: debug
  metrics_host: metrics.holath.qorvelsys.internal
  pin: 2191
  pool_size: 32

**Management Minutes — Quillard Appliances, Ops Review**

Finance folks, heads up: warranty costs on the Hearthline kettle range are running 40% over budget. Tomas Brey traced most of it to a faulty seal batch from the Dunmoor plant. We've paused shipments and the supplier is making noises about partial compensation. Priya wants a revised provision in the next forecast, and Sales is nervous about retailer chatter. We agreed to keep messaging low-key for now. The confidential note below sets out the plan.

confidential, kagup-bafog: Fraaxax Group is in early talks to buy Soroxox Group for about $343.8 million. The Olidor launch date is June 14, and nothing goes to the press before then. Legal wants the Aldmirek Logistics term sheet signed before July 23.

## Limits and Quotas: Relay Breaker for the Plumage API

The Fernway gateway wraps all outbound calls to the Plumage API in a circuit breaker. When the rolling error rate exceeds the trip threshold within the sampling window, the breaker opens and requests fail fast, preventing credential-stuffing amplification and upstream exhaustion. Half-open probes are rate-limited and logged for audit. The enforced limits, reviewed quarterly, are as follows.

tuning constants:
QUOTAS = {
    "druwyn": 5,
    "holix": 5,
    "zorath": 5,
    "holwyn": 10,
}

## Releases

Hey, welcome to Skylark Metrics! As of v3.1 we gzip all telemetry payloads before shipping them to the collector — cuts bandwidth roughly 70%. Build the release with `make dist`, confirm the compressed fixtures pass the round-trip test, then sign the artifact. The deploy pipeline verifies everything against this key:

rollout seal: bky4_x7Gc